Embodiment Construction

[0013] refer to figure 1 , figure 2 , image 3 and Figure 4 , a prestressed adjustable piezoelectric vibrator jacquard guide needle of the present invention is composed of a piezoelectric vibrator 1, a guide needle 2, and a pre-tightened piezoelectric ceramic 3, wherein:

[0014] The piezoelectric vibrator 1 is composed of an elastic substrate 11 and a piezoelectric ceramic 12. The elastic substrate 11 includes two side cantilevers 111, a middle cantilever 112, a base connection area 113 and a needle connection area 114; the two side cantilever 111 is arranged symmetrically with respect to the middle cantilever 112, and the piezoelectric ceramic 12 is pasted on the upper and lower surfaces of the two side cantilevers 111; the end of the middle cantilever 112 close to the base connection area 113 is arranged with a bent plate pretensioning arm 1121, and the bent plate The plate pretension arm 1121 is a thin plate structure folded into a V shape along the length direction, ...

Abstract

The invention relates to a pre-stress-adjustable piezoelectric vibrator Jacquard guide needle. The pre-stress-adjustable piezoelectric vibrator Jacquard guide needle includes a piezoelectric vibrator,a guide needle head, and pre-tensioning piezoelectric ceramics; the piezoelectric vibrator includes an elastic substrate and piezoelectric ceramics; the elastic substrate includes two side suspensionarms, an intermediate suspension arm, a base connection region and a needle head connection region; the piezoelectric ceramics are stuck to upper and lower surfaces of the two side suspension arms; acurved plate pre-tensioning arm is arranged on the intermediate suspension arm; the curved plate pre-tensioning arm is folded into a V-shaped thin plate structure in the length direction, and includes two rectangular surfaces which form a certain included angle; the pre-tensioning piezoelectric ceramics are stuck to the two rectangular surfaces of the curved plate pre-tensioning arm, apply a direct voltage to generate a pre-stress; and the guide needle head is arranged on a tail end of the needle head connection region of the elastic substrate. The pre-stress-adjustable piezoelectric vibratorJacquard guide needle is widely applied in the field of piezoelectric ceramics warp knitting machines; compared with the conventional pre-stress-adjustable piezoelectric vibrator Jacquard guide needles, the pre-stress-adjustable piezoelectric vibrator Jacquard guide needle is easy to assemble, and is adjustable in pre-stress.

Description

technical field [0001] The invention belongs to the technical field of piezoelectric ceramic warp knitting machines, and in particular relates to a prestressed adjustable piezoelectric vibrator jacquard guide needle. Background technique [0002] The jacquard guide needle is used in the jacquard warp knitting machine and is the key component to realize the jacquard function. The deflection of the guide needle is realized by using the inverse piezoelectric effect. The polarized piezoelectric ceramic chip will produce contraction and extension deformation when applied with voltage, so that the yarn guide needle will deviate to the left or to the right. Among the existing jacquard yarn guide needles, some use ordinary rectangular piezoelectric vibrators, and some use prestressed piezoelectric vibrators. The prestressed piezoelectric vibrator has the advantages of long service life, low required voltage, and large output displacement, which have been verified theoretically and ...
